Shanghai Battles Covid-19 Outbreaks in Another Elderly-Care Hospital


At least two major elderly-care facilities in Shanghai are battling Covid-19 outbreaks, highlighting the threat posed to the city’s large senior population from a wave of infections with the Omicron variant. Over the past week, Shanghai Tongkang Hospital, with more than 1,000 patients, has been quarantining a group of Covid-infected patients and medical workers in a designated building, according to relatives of some of the patients. On Thursday, the Journal reported that at least 100 patients had tested positive for Covid-19 and many patients died at Donghai Elderly Care Hospital, the city’s biggest elderly-care facility by capacity, according to orderlies brought in recently to fill in for workers sent away to quarantine and other people familiar with the situation. Shanghai’s government hasn’t reported any Covid outbreak at either Donghai Hospital or Tongkang Hospital. Nor has it reported any Covid-related death at any of its hundreds of elderly-care centers.
